What Is Bone Density?
Bone thickness describes the amount of mineral content in your bones, specifically calcium and phosphorus, which determines their strength and structure. Healthy and balanced bone density is crucial for overall bone wellness, as it helps protect against cracks and supports your body's various functions. When your bone thickness is optimum, your bones can withstand everyday stress and anxieties and pressures without breaking.

Impact on Dental Implants
Sufficient bone thickness is important for the success of oral implants. When you undergo a dental implant procedure, the dental implant demands to incorporate with your jawbone, supplying stability and stamina. If your bone thickness is insufficient, the implant may not fuse correctly, resulting in issues like implant failing. You want a tough structure for your implant, and low bone thickness can jeopardize that.
Inadequate bone thickness can also affect the positioning of the dental implant. If the bone isn't dense sufficient to sustain the dental implant, your dentist may need to position it in a much less ideal setting, which can result in imbalance and pain. This can influence your ability to chew and speak efficiently.
In addition, reduced bone density can raise the risk of infection around the implant site. Without solid bone support, the body might have a hard time to heal properly, which can lead to concerns further down the line.
Eventually, ensuring you have enough bone thickness not only boosts the immediate success of your oral implant however likewise improves your long-term dental health and performance. So, before proceeding with implants, it's vital to analyze your bone thickness and talk about any worry about your dental expert.
Solutions for Reduced Bone Density
If you're facing reduced bone density and thinking about oral implants, there are a number of reliable options to discover.
Initially, your dental professional could suggest bone grafting, where they utilize bone material from another part of your body or a contributor to reconstruct the bone structure in your jaw. This procedure can produce a stronger structure for your implants.
